The New York Times published a great article about Mac User Groups, including a video feature about Lonnie Mimms, a computer collector who’s built his own Apple museum in an abandoned CompUSA building. The video opens with the sound of an Apple ][ floppy disk drive spinning up, which transported me to my uncle’s study when I was a kid, where I would spend hours playing Ultima III (or “]I[“) and other geeky explorations during family get-togethers.
